Darwinia
Darwinia merges en tiempo real strategy, action, and puzzle-solving in a retro-inspired digital universe. Players take on the role of a hacker navigating a vibrant, abstract world created by Dr. Sepulveda, where evolving AI beings called Darwinians face threats from a destructive virus. Using an innovative gesture-based control system, players draw shapes to command units, direct attacks, and solve intricate challenges. The game’s unique mechanics blend tactical decision-making with fast-paced jugabilidad, offering dynamic objectives and escalating difficulty. Visually, Darwinia stands out with bold, polygon-driven art that echoes 80s classics like *Tron* and *Defender*, paired with smooth animations that enhance immersion. Recognized with the Seumas McNally Grand Prize at IGF 2006, Darwinia has been fully remastered for modern platforms, preserving its original charm while refining performance.
